Slackware alert SSA:2004-124-02 (sysklogd)

From:  Slackware Security Team <security@slackware.com>
To:  slackware-security@slackware.com
Subject:  [slackware-security] sysklogd update (SSA:2004-124-02)
Date:  Mon, 3 May 2004 13:06:43 -0700 (PDT)

-----BEGIN PGP SIGNED MESSAGE----- Hash: SHA1 [slackware-security] sysklogd update (SSA:2004-124-02) New sysklogd packages are available for Slackware 8.1, 9.0, 9.1, and -current to fix a security issue where a user could cause syslogd to crash. Thanks to Steve Grubb who researched the issue. Here are the details from the Slackware 9.1 ChangeLog: +--------------------------+ Sun May 2 17:16:41 PDT 2004 patches/packages/sysklogd-1.4.1-i486-9.tgz: Patched a bug which could allow a user to cause syslogd to write to unallocated memory and crash. Thanks to Steve Grubb for finding the bug, and Solar Designer for refining the patch.
